Rehabilitation & Therapeutic Professions is the 38th most popular major in the country with 28,859 degrees awarded in 2019-2020. In 2017-2018, rehabilitation and therapeutic professions graduates who were awarded their degree in 2015-2017, earned an average of $60,273 and had an average of $67,296 in loans still to pay off.

Across New Jersey, there were 371 rehabilitation and therapeutic professions graduates with average earnings and debt of $68,375 and $62,896 respectively. At the associate degree level specifically, there were 29 rehabilitation and therapeutic professions graduates with average earnings and debt of $36,475 and $14,203 respectively.
